Application & Eligibility
Applicants must be citizens of an African country and meet the academic requirements for the chosen mobility track. Eligibility may vary depending on the host institution.
Yes, you may select multiple preferred institutions, but final placement depends on program availability and evaluation results.
Scholarship & Funding
The scholarship covers tuition fees, travel, monthly allowances, insurance and research-related costs as defined under the Intra-Africa Mobility Scheme.
No. PAP2SN does not require any application or participation fees. Beware of fraudulent requests.
Documents & Requirements
Required documents include academic transcripts, CV, passport copy, motivation letter, and nomination letter. Templates are available in the Downloads section.
Documents must be uploaded through the PAP2SN Navigator App or sent through the official online portal during the application window.
Mobility & Study Tracks
Mobility duration depends on the program: Short-term, Semester, Masters, or PhD-level stays.
Extensions may be granted only under exceptional circumstances and require approval from both host and home institutions.
